Panasonic DMRES10
Product Rating     
Panasonic DIGA DVD Recorders offer all the benefits of the DVD-RAM format, like simultaneous recording and playback, random access, chasing playback, on-disc editing, and multi-format data compatibility that lets you record TV programs and still pictures on the same disc. The new Panasonic DMRES10 is the latest edition to the hugely successful DIGA portfolio. With new picture enhancing technology delivering stunning digital video quality, this new DVD recorder is sure to make waves in 2005. The DMRES10 is ready to record just one second after switching on the power - meaning the very first seconds of a programme can be caught.Vital scenes will be captured, meaning you will never miss the start of your favourite programme again.The vital opening scene of your favourite soap or league match will no longer be a mystery.
Features of the Panasonic DMRES10 include:
- 2 x LP Horizontal Resolution (500)
- 1 Sec.Quick Start for Recording
- Multi-Format Recording and Playback
- 12bit Analog-to-Digital Converter
- PAL Progressive Scan
- Dolby Digital 2ch Recording System
- Playable Discs - DVD-RAM, DVD-R, DVD-RW(VR Format), +R, +RW, DVD-Video, DVD-Audio,CD-Audio(CD-DA), Video CD,CD-R/RW (CD-DA,Video CD,MP3,JPEG formatted discs)
- Recordable Discs - DVD-RAM :Ver.2.0, Ver.2.1/3x Speed DVD-RAM Revision 1.0, Ver.2.2/5x Speed DVD-RAM Revision 2.05, DVD-R: 33 for General Ver. 2.0/4x Speed DVD-R Revision1.0, for General Ver.2x/8x Speed DVD-R Revision 3.0 DVD-RW:Ver.1.1, Ver.1.1/2x-SPEED DVD-RW Revision 1.0, Ver.1.2 /4x-SPEED; DVD-RW Revision 2.05+R:3Ver.1.0, Ver.1.1, Ver.1.25
- Recording Standards - DVD Video Recording Format (DVD-RAM),DVD Video Format (DVD-R,DVD-RW)
- Recording Time - XP Mode
Approx. 1 hour(with 4.7GB disc)
- SP Mode - Approx. 2 hours (with 4.7GB disc)
- LP Mode - Approx. 4 hours (with 4.7GB disc)
- EP Mode - Approx. 8 hours (with 4.7GB disc)
- Tuner System - PAL-l
- Channel Coverage - UHF CH 21-68
- Video System - PAL colour signal, 625 lines, 50 fields/NTSC colour signal, 525 lines, 60 fields
- Recording System - MPEG2 (Hybrid VBR)
- Input - Video In AV1/AV2 (21 pin), AV3 / AV4 (pin jack)
- Input - S-Video Out AV2 (21 pin) AV3 /AV4 (S terminal)
- Input - RGB In AV2 (21 pin) (PAL)
- Output - Video Out AV1 /AV2 (21 pin),Video out (pin jack)
- Output - Video Out AV1 /AV2 (21 pin),Video out (pin jack)
- Output - S-Video Out AV1 (21 pin),S-Video out (S terminal)
- Output - RGB Out AV1, 21 pin/PAL
- Component Video Output
Y:1.0 Vp-p;75 ohm, PB: 0.7 Vp-p; 75 ohm, PR: 0.7 Vp-p; 75 ohm
- Recording System Input - Audio In AV1 /AV2 (21 pin) AV3 / AV4 (pin jack)
- Output - Audio Out 2ch, AV1 /AV2 /21 pin), Audio out (pin jack)
- Output - Digital Audio Out
Optical terminal (PCM, Dolby Digital, DTS, MPEG)

It records all formats (DVD-RAM, DVD-R, DVD+R, DD-RW), unless DVD+RW. With DVD-RAM you get exceptionally powerful editing capabilities. For example, with DVD-RAM, you can even watch a program at the same time that it is being recorded, with a time diference of only 5 SECONDS behind !. The disc menu is increadibly exciting with true live thumbnail pictures that play the titles as you move the cursor throughout them. You can change the sequence of the chapters, move, rename titles, shorten titles, erase comercials, etc... Best of all, this set treats the DVD-RAM or DVD-RW just like a hard drive. That means, if you erase a title that was recorded in the beginning of the disc, the reamining time will automatically increase ! You never have to worry about recording over an older recorded title. Timer recording is super easy, you can name the future recording BEFORE the machine actually records it, so you will always know what you´ve recorded ! It even tells you, acording to remainig time left in the disc, until what date that particular programmed recording will be possible. There is a "PHRASE BANK", so you do not have to re-type the name of a title every time you want to record it, and so on...
